A major I-15 south accident today has caused significant traffic disruption in Temecula, California, after a multi-vehicle collision prompted an emergency response and the closure of several southbound lanes.

The crash reportedly occurred during the morning commute, with California Highway Patrol officers, firefighters, paramedics and recovery crews responding to the scene. Multiple damaged vehicles were left blocking portions of the highway, creating extensive backups for motorists traveling through Riverside County.

What Happened

According to the information provided, the collision involved several passenger vehicles and at least one commercial truck on southbound Interstate 15. The impact created debris across the roadway and required emergency crews to establish a protected area while they assessed those involved and began clearing the wreckage.

The resulting congestion spread across nearby routes, with motorists experiencing lengthy delays. Drivers approaching the affected section were advised to use alternate routes where possible.

Latest Updates

Emergency crews remained at the scene while damaged vehicles were removed and debris was cleared from the highway. California Highway Patrol officers were also investigating the circumstances surrounding the collision.

Several people reportedly received medical evaluations, with some transported to nearby hospitals for further treatment. No fatalities were reported in the information provided, although the full extent of injuries should be confirmed through official authorities.
